Deep Dive: Ascendant (Rising) in Pisces

Understanding Your Pisces Ascendant

When you were born, Pisces was rising on the eastern horizon—this is what astrologers call your Ascendant or Rising sign. Think of it as the "dawn" of your birth chart, the point where you first emerged into the world.

Unlike your Sun sign (which represents your core identity) or your Moon sign (which governs your emotions), your Rising sign shapes how you present yourself to the world and how others initially perceive you. It's not a fake mask—it's a genuine part of who you are, determining your spontaneous reactions and your physical presence.

The Importance of Neptune as Your Chart Ruler

Because Pisces is rising in your chart, Neptune becomes your chart ruler. This planet is incredibly significant—more important than any other planetary placement except your Sun and Moon. The house and sign where Neptune sits points to your primary life focus and the areas where you'll invest the most energy.

For example, if your chart-ruling Neptune is in your 10th house, career and public reputation will be central themes. If it's in your 7th house, relationships and partnerships will take priority. Understanding Neptune's placement is essential to understanding yourself.

Because your 1st House of Self is Pisces, your 7th House of Partnership is ruled by Virgo. This is the 'Descendant.' We often seek what we lack. While you project an image of being Pisces, you deeply crave partners who are Virgo. You likely attract people who embody Virgo qualities to balance your energy.

This is the law of polarity. You are learning to master Pisces independence, so you subconsciously draw in Virgo energy to teach you about cooperation and the 'Other.' Your ideal partner provides the Virgo traits that you don't naturally express.

Your Rising sign sets the structure for your career houses. With Pisces Rising, your 10th House of Career and Public Reputation is likely colored bySagittarius. This suggests you want to be known professionally as someone who is Sagittarius. You approach leadership and ambition with a Sagittarius style.

While you wear a mask of Pisces in public, your 4th House of Home and Family is likely Gemini. This represents your 'soft underbelly.' Behind closed doors, you drop the Pisces armor and likely behave more like a Gemini—seeking comfort, security, and emotional grounding in your private sanctuary.

The Earth rotates rapidly. The Rising sign changes approximately every 2 hours, and the specific degree changes every 4 minutes. Being born just 20 minutes later could shift your degree, changing your House cusps and potentially your entire Chart Ruler.
